ILWU members and their community supporters will be gathering in a community march down Harbor Blvd. in San Pedro on Thursday, January 22, 2014 at 5:00 p.m.to show unification against the unilateral actions PMA has taken against union workers. Please read the Press release below from Los Angeles City Councilman Joe Buscaino’s office, and join in the rally! “The PMAs action in further cutting night shifts at the Ports of Los Angeles and Long Beach is another step closer to a lockout. It’s the wrong time to take the type of actions that will hurt the hard working residents that I represent. It will only serve to worsen the slowdown and congestion at the ports, disrupt the global supply chain, and result in irreparable damage to the reputation of our ports complex at a time when competition is peaking. I believe we are at a point where there may be no winners in the end. I beg the PMA to come to a resolution by allowing the ILWU jurisdiction over the chassis issue and bring our economic engine back to efficient operation before we lose business permanently. When America had a thriving middle class one in three workers had a union. Today we have the largest wage gap in history because only one in 10 workers are represented by unions. As a show of unity with the ILWU, over 5000 people are expected to join the march ending at the San Pedro Downtown Harbor with a rally and concert by the Flying Squad.
